Adjective [edit]
overdetermined (comparative more overdetermined, superlative most overdetermined)
- (of a problem or question) which suffers so many constraints that it has no solution.
- (linear algebra, of a system of linear equations) which has more equations than variables.
- (usually psychoanalysis) be determined by multiple causes in such a way that any of the causes on its own would be sufficient to account for the effect.
